A Unique Investment in Multifamily Real Estate
NAS Investment Solutions (NASDAQ: COOT), a recognized leader in passive real estate investments, recently finalized the acquisition of The Courtyard Apartments, a multifamily property in the Dallas area. This asset presents an exciting fractional investment opportunity for those looking to diversify their portfolios or engage in a 1031 exchange. The Courtyard Apartments showcase a promising prospect for investors aiming for a steady income stream and long-term growth.
Strategic Location Matters
The Courtyard is strategically positioned near one of Texas's most dynamic economic hubs—the Telecom Corridor. This area spans a remarkable 6.5 miles along U.S. Highway 75 and is home to over 130,000 jobs and an impressive 25 million square feet of office space. Such proximity to significant employment centers makes this property incredibly attractive for maintaining high occupancy rates.

Enhancing Property Value with Upgrades
Set on a 5.5-acre site, The Courtyard Apartments boasts 123 units that are expected to see value-added enhancements. Among the proposed upgrades are the installation of in-unit washers and dryers, which will likely attract higher rents and improve overall cash flow.
Amenity-Rich Living Experience
The Courtyard Apartments offer a wide range of amenities that contribute to a satisfying resident experience. Features include a tennis court, a swimming pool, a BBQ area, a business center, and on-site management with 24-hour emergency maintenance. These amenities are designed to foster tenant satisfaction and retention, ultimately stabilizing net operating income.
Attractive Unit Designs
The interiors of the units at The Courtyard deliver a strong visual appeal. They feature lofty ceilings, stylish hardwood-style flooring, and ample closet space. Private outdoor areas such as patios or balconies enhance the living experience. Upgraded kitchens come with stainless steel appliances, granite countertops, and select fixtures that raise the property's profile.
